Buying Jobs in Wisconsin

A Buyer in the retail industry is responsible for selecting and purchasing stocks. They analyze consumer buying patterns and predict future trends. Regularly reviewing performance indicators, such as sales and discount levels, also falls under their work purview. They are crucial in managing plans for stock levels, reacting to changes in demand, and logistics. Additionally, they meet suppliers and negotiate terms of the contract, which may include aspects like price, delivery, and specifications. In essence, a Buyer ensures that their retail organization has a constant supply of goods, at the right price and quality.

Skillsets for this role include excellent commercial awareness, strong numerical skills, high-level negotiation skills, and the ability to understand customer needs and buying behavior. Certifications like Certified Professional in Supply Management (CPSM) or Certified Purchasing Professional (CPP) may prove beneficial. Prior to becoming a Buyer, individuals may have roles such as Purchasing Assistant, Merchandising Assistant, or Junior Buyer. These positions provide valuable experience in inventory management, supplier relations, and understanding market trends, laying a firm foundation for a successful career as a Buyer in the retail industry.
